COMMERCIAL DESCRIPTION
Our holiday seasonal is brewed with German malts, Czech hops and Belgian yeast, yielding a very drinkable strong beer with hints of caramel and fruity yeast flavors.

Capitol Hill brewpub. Deep golden body with a medium thick, white head. Aroma of sautéed bananas and sweet malt and honey tones. Flavor has a nutty, shredded wheat aspect and some prominent Belgian yeast characters. Fairly sweet, but tasty. I enjoyed my pint of this. Decent American weizen bock, although it could be drier.
